Web4 de abr. de 2024 · Step 1: Prepare the multimeter To check a 12 volt coil, set the multimeter to at least a 200 Ohms setting. Attach both leads of the meter to the coil-terminals with black to the negative terminal and red to the positive one. Step 2: Test the resistance The normal, acceptable range for a standard 12-volt car is 1.5 to 1.7 Ohms.
